1. Enhanced Water Consistency
Pressure tanks play a critical role in ensuring a stable and consistent water supply:
Uniform Water Pressure: These tanks maintain a steady pressure level, preventing sudden fluctuations that can disrupt daily activities, such as cooking, cleaning, and gardening. A reliable water supply is essential for comfort and convenience in any setting.
Buffer During High Demand: Pressure tanks store water under pressure, allowing them to meet peak demand without requiring the pump to run continuously. This capability is particularly useful during high usage periods, such as mornings when multiple household members may need water simultaneously.
2. Energy Efficiency and Cost Savings
Integrating pressure tanks into water management systems can lead to significant energy savings:
Reduced Pump Cycling: By providing a reserve of pressurized water, pressure tanks minimize the number of times the pump needs to activate. This reduction in cycling not only extends the pump's lifespan but also decreases energy consumption.
Lower Utility Bills: With less reliance on the pump, users can enjoy lower energy costs. Over time, these savings can add up, making pressure tanks a cost-effective solution for managing water supplies.

4. Versatile Applications
Pressure tanks are adaptable to a wide range of applications:
Residential Use: In homes, pressure tanks are essential for maintaining water pressure for showers, faucets, and irrigation systems. They ensure a smooth and efficient water supply for everyday activities.
Commercial and Industrial Applications: Businesses, such as restaurants, hotels, and manufacturing facilities, rely on pressure tanks to manage larger water systems. These tanks improve operational efficiency by providing consistent water delivery and reducing strain on pumps.
Agricultural Use: In agriculture, pressure tanks are vital for irrigation systems. They help deliver stable water pressure to crops, ensuring efficient hydration and promoting healthy growth.
